Get the stories that matter to you sent straight to your inbox with our daily newsletter.Dumfries and Galloway has seen no new coronavirus cases for the second day running.It means the total remains at 4,134, where it has stood since four cases were confirmed on Saturday.There are currently less than five people in hospital.The seven day positivity rate for the region is 21.5 per 100,000 people, with a test positivity rate of 1.1 per cent.

Nicola Sturgeon lights candle in tribute to Sarah Everard and other victims of male violence

Nicola Sturgeon has lit a candle at her home in memory of Sarah Everard and victims of male violence. The First Minister joined thousands across Scotland in paying tribute to the 33-year-old marketing executive, who was found dead in London earlier this week.
